Mobile Mechanic in Raeford, NC
Growth got ahead of the garages
Mobile mechanic work in Raeford answers a mismatch the whole Sandhills knows: Hoke County has been one of North Carolina's fastest-growing counties for years, its subdivisions filling with commuters and Fort Bragg families along Highway 401 and Fayetteville Road — but the repair infrastructure didn't grow at the same pace. When the nearest trusted shop is twenty-five minutes away in Fayetteville, every repair carries an unpaid tax in drives, shuttles and waiting. Driveway service deletes the tax: same diagnostics, same brake jobs, same quoted-first pricing, at your address in Raeford.

Frequently asked questions — Raeford
Do you charge extra to come to Raeford?
No — Raeford is standard service territory at Fayetteville pricing. The whole model exists for towns where the shop drive is the expensive part.
Do you cover rural addresses outside Raeford?
Generally yes across Hoke County — give the location when you call and scheduling gets confirmed honestly.
Can you do a full brake job at my house in Raeford?
Yes — pads, rotors and calipers are everyday driveway work. A level parking spot is the only site requirement.
